fix: 对冲代码审计修复

Bug修复:
1. 信号+回撤同时触发→只做回撤锁仓(更严重), 避免重复对冲
2. 信号解锁收紧: 同向需信号>unhedge_threshold(1.0), 而非>0
3. 新增回撤恢复解锁: 浮亏回到阈值以上自动解锁

逻辑测试: 6/6 通过
